+/*
+ * This is sent back as a general response to the login command.
+ * It can be either an error or a success, depending on the
+ * precense of certain TLVs.
+ *
+ * The client should check the value passed as errorcode. If
+ * its nonzero, there was an error.
+ *
+ */
+faim_internal int aim_authparse(struct aim_session_t *sess,
+ struct command_rx_struct *command)
+{
+ struct aim_tlvlist_t *tlvlist;
+ int ret = 1;
+ rxcallback_t userfunc = NULL;
+ char *sn = NULL, *bosip = NULL, *errurl = NULL, *email = NULL;
+ unsigned char *cookie = NULL;
+ int errorcode = 0, regstatus = 0;
+ int latestbuild = 0, latestbetabuild = 0;
+ char *latestrelease = NULL, *latestbeta = NULL;
+ char *latestreleaseurl = NULL, *latestbetaurl = NULL;
+ char *latestreleaseinfo = NULL, *latestbetainfo = NULL;
+
+ /*
+ * Read block of TLVs. All further data is derived
+ * from what is parsed here.
+ *
+ * For SNAC login, there's a 17/3 SNAC header in front.
+ *
+ */
+ if (sess->flags & AIM_SESS_FLAGS_SNACLOGIN)
+ tlvlist = aim_readtlvchain(command->data+10, command->commandlen-10);
+ else
+ tlvlist = aim_readtlvchain(command->data, command->commandlen);
+
+ /*
+ * No matter what, we should have a screen name.
+ */
+ memset(sess->sn, 0, sizeof(sess->sn));
+ if (aim_gettlv(tlvlist, 0x0001, 1)) {
+ sn = aim_gettlv_str(tlvlist, 0x0001, 1);
+ strncpy(sess->sn, sn, sizeof(sess->sn));
+ }
+
+ /*
+ * Check for an error code. If so, we should also
+ * have an error url.
+ */
+ if (aim_gettlv(tlvlist, 0x0008, 1))
+ errorcode = aim_gettlv16(tlvlist, 0x0008, 1);
+ if (aim_gettlv(tlvlist, 0x0004, 1))
+ errurl = aim_gettlv_str(tlvlist, 0x0004, 1);
+
+ /*
+ * BOS server address.
+ */
+ if (aim_gettlv(tlvlist, 0x0005, 1))
+ bosip = aim_gettlv_str(tlvlist, 0x0005, 1);
+
+ /*
+ * Authorization cookie.
+ */
+ if (aim_gettlv(tlvlist, 0x0006, 1)) {
+ struct aim_tlv_t *tmptlv;
+
+ tmptlv = aim_gettlv(tlvlist, 0x0006, 1);
+
+ if ((cookie = malloc(tmptlv->length)))
+ memcpy(cookie, tmptlv->value, tmptlv->length);
+ }
+
+ /*
+ * The email address attached to this account
+ * Not available for ICQ logins.
+ */
+ if (aim_gettlv(tlvlist, 0x0011, 1))
+ email = aim_gettlv_str(tlvlist, 0x0011, 1);
+
+ /*
+ * The registration status. (Not real sure what it means.)
+ * Not available for ICQ logins.
+ *
+ * 1 = No disclosure
+ * 2 = Limited disclosure
+ * 3 = Full disclosure
+ *
+ * This has to do with whether your email address is available
+ * to other users or not. AFAIK, this feature is no longer used.
+ *
+ */
+ if (aim_gettlv(tlvlist, 0x0013, 1))
+ regstatus = aim_gettlv16(tlvlist, 0x0013, 1);
+
+ if (aim_gettlv(tlvlist, 0x0040, 1))
+ latestbetabuild = aim_gettlv32(tlvlist, 0x0040, 1);
+ if (aim_gettlv(tlvlist, 0x0041, 1))
+ latestbetaurl = aim_gettlv_str(tlvlist, 0x0041, 1);
+ if (aim_gettlv(tlvlist, 0x0042, 1))
+ latestbetainfo = aim_gettlv_str(tlvlist, 0x0042, 1);
+ if (aim_gettlv(tlvlist, 0x0043, 1))
+ latestbeta = aim_gettlv_str(tlvlist, 0x0043, 1);
+ if (aim_gettlv(tlvlist, 0x0048, 1))
+ ; /* no idea what this is */
+
+ if (aim_gettlv(tlvlist, 0x0044, 1))
+ latestbuild = aim_gettlv32(tlvlist, 0x0044, 1);
+ if (aim_gettlv(tlvlist, 0x0045, 1))
+ latestreleaseurl = aim_gettlv_str(tlvlist, 0x0045, 1);
+ if (aim_gettlv(tlvlist, 0x0046, 1))
+ latestreleaseinfo = aim_gettlv_str(tlvlist, 0x0046, 1);
+ if (aim_gettlv(tlvlist, 0x0047, 1))
+ latestrelease = aim_gettlv_str(tlvlist, 0x0047, 1);
+ if (aim_gettlv(tlvlist, 0x0049, 1))
+ ; /* no idea what this is */
+
+
+ if ((userfunc = aim_callhandler(command->conn, 0x0017, 0x0003)))
+ ret = userfunc(sess, command, sn, errorcode, errurl, regstatus, email, bosip, cookie, latestrelease, latestbuild, latestreleaseurl, latestreleaseinfo, latestbeta, latestbetabuild, latestbetaurl, latestbetainfo);
+
+
+ if (sn)
+ free(sn);
+ if (bosip)
+ free(bosip);
+ if (errurl)
+ free(errurl);
+ if (email)
+ free(email);
+ if (cookie)
+ free(cookie);
+ if (latestrelease)
+ free(latestrelease);
+ if (latestreleaseurl)
+ free(latestreleaseurl);
+ if (latestbeta)
+ free(latestbeta);
+ if (latestbetaurl)
+ free(latestbetaurl);
+ if (latestreleaseinfo)
+ free(latestreleaseinfo);
+ if (latestbetainfo)
+ free(latestbetainfo);
+
+ aim_freetlvchain(&tlvlist);
+
+ return ret;
+}

+/*
+ * Middle handler for 0017/0007 SNACs. Contains the auth key prefixed
+ * by only its length in a two byte word.
+ *
+ * Calls the client, which should then use the value to call aim_send_login.
+ *
+ */
+faim_internal int aim_authkeyparse(struct aim_session_t *sess, struct command_rx_struct *command)
+{
+ unsigned char *key;
+ int keylen;
+ int ret = 1;
+ rxcallback_t userfunc;
+
+ keylen = aimutil_get16(command->data+10);
+ if (!(key = malloc(keylen+1)))
+ return ret;
+ memcpy(key, command->data+12, keylen);
+ key[keylen] = '\0';
+
+ if ((userfunc = aim_callhandler(command->conn, 0x0017, 0x0007)))
+ ret = userfunc(sess, command, (char *)key);
+
+ free(key);
+
+ return ret;
+}
